Shauna Pomerantz and Rebecca Raby presented a paper at the Congress of the Social Sciences and Humanitites (Canadian Society for Studies in Education) entitled “The New (Post) Nerd”: Smart Girls, Post-Feminism, and Popular Culture in Fredericton, NB on June 1.

Zopito Marini from Child and Youth Studies and Andrew Dane from Psychology presented their research “Emotion Regulation in Overt and Relational Forms of Reactive Aggression: Differential Relations with Temperament” in an invited symposium entitled “Emotion regulation: Bio-Psychosocial Perspectives” at the 12th European Congress of Psychology in Istanbul, Turkey on July 4 to 8.

Also at that conference:

  • Melissa Prior, a graduate student in Child and Youth Studies, presented her honour’s thesis “Developmental Trajectories in face recognition in age and Sex Effects.”
  • Ayda Tekok-Kilic, assistant professor, presented her research “Fetal Alcohol Spectrum Disorders: An Exploration of Working Memory and Executive functioning.”

Ayda Tekok-Kilic also presented her research “Activational patterns of the Frontal-parietal networks During Oculomotor delayed Response Tasks: An Event-related Potential Study” at the 51st annual meeting of Psychophysiological Research in Boston, Mass. on Sept. 14 to 18.
